–noun
1.
a cat; pussy.
2.
Informal
.
a person or thing not at all threatening:
a pussycat underneath all his gruffness.
Origin:
1795–1805;
pussy
1
+
cat
1

puss·y·cat
(pŏŏs'ē-kāt')
n.
A cat.
Informal
One who is regarded as easygoing, mild-mannered, or amiable.
